How much do google apps script developer j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 9, 2026, the average yearly pay for google apps script developer in California is $105,188.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$65,100.00 and $126,300.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a Google Apps Script developer?

A Google Apps Script Developer designs, develops, and maintains custom automation solutions using Google Apps Script, a JavaScript-based scripting language for Google Workspace applications like Sheets, Docs, and Gmail. They create scripts to automate repetitive tasks, integrate third-party APIs, and improve workflow efficiency. This role requires strong JavaScript skills, familiarity with Google Workspace APIs, and problem-solving abilities to build tailored automation solutions for businesses.

What does a Google Apps Script developer do?

As a Google Apps Script Developer, your daily tasks often involve writing and maintaining scripts that automate tasks within Google Workspace applications like Sheets, Docs, Gmail, and Drive. You may collaborate closely with business stakeholders to understand workflow needs, design solutions, and troubleshoot existing scripts or integrations. Additionally, updating documentation, responding to support requests, and staying current with Google Workspace updates are important responsibilities. This role provides a dynamic environment where problem-solving and communication are key, as you frequently support various teams and projects across the organization.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Google Apps Script developer?

To thrive as a Google Apps Script Developer, you need strong proficiency in JavaScript, an understanding of the Google Workspace ecosystem, and experience with automating workflows or creating custom applications. Familiarity with the Google Apps Script editor, Google Cloud Platform, and relevant APIs, as well as having certifications in Google Workspace or cloud technologies, are often valuable. Exceptional problem-solving, communication, and project management skills help developers understand client needs and deliver effective solutions. These skills ensure developers can efficiently optimize business processes, collaborate with cross-functional teams, and adapt to evolving technical requirements.
